FDSR refers to Field Disturbance Sensor Rejection and when turned on, is designed to identify all radar based collision avoidance and blind spot detection systems that operate within K band radar. Blind Spot Monitoring, or BSM, is a type of technology installed on many newer vehicles that can detect and monitor other vehicles around it, such those approaching from the side and rear. A radar detector detector (RDD) is a device used by police or law enforcement in areas where radar detectors are declared illegal.. Radar detectors are built around a superheterodyne receiver, which has a local oscillator that radiates slightly. what does k band mean on a radar detector.
